CyberRota Analysis
AI-GeneratedThe vulnerability affects Oracle WebCenter Portal within Oracle Fusion Middleware, specifically in versions 12.2.1.4.0 and 14.1.2.0.0, allowing unauthenticated attackers with network access to exploit it via HTTP. Successful exploitation can lead to unauthorized access to sensitive data and the ability to modify or delete data within the portal. Organizations using the affected versions should prioritize patching this vulnerability to mitigate the risk of data breaches and integrity issues.

Original NVD Description
Vulnerability in the Oracle WebCenter Portal product of Oracle Fusion Middleware (component: Runtime Tools). Supported versions that are affected are 12.2.1.4.0 and 14.1.2.0.0. Easily exploitable vulnerability allows unauthenticated attacker with network access via HTTP to compromise Oracle WebCenter Portal. Successful attacks of this vulnerability can result in unauthorized access to critical data or complete access to all Oracle WebCenter Portal accessible data as well as unauthorized update, insert or delete access to some of Oracle WebCenter Portal accessible data. CVSS 3.1 Base Score 8.2 (Confidentiality and Integrity impacts). C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:L/A:N).
